Speech synthesis software refers to programs designed to convert written text into spoken words. These technologies are commonly used in applications such as virtual assistants, accessibility tools, and language learning platforms. By utilizing complex algorithms, speech synthesis software can produce human-like speech from text inputs, making it a valuable tool for both personal and professional use.

Key Features of Speech Synthesis Software:

  • Text-to-speech conversion with various voice options.
  • Support for multiple languages and accents.
  • Customizable speech speed and pitch.
  • Real-time processing for seamless communication.

"Speech synthesis technologies are continually improving to provide more natural and expressive voices, enhancing the user experience across various devices and platforms."

Common Uses of Speech Synthesis Software:

  1. Accessibility: Helping visually impaired individuals access written content.
  2. Virtual Assistants: Enabling communication with AI-powered systems like Siri and Alexa.
  3. Education: Assisting language learners by reading aloud text in foreign languages.

Comparison of Different Speech Synthesis Technologies:

Software Language Support Voice Customization Price
Google Text-to-Speech Multiple languages Basic Free
IBM Watson Text to Speech Multiple languages Advanced Paid
Amazon Polly Multiple languages Moderate Paid

What is Speech Synthesis Software and How Does it Work?

Speech synthesis software is a technology designed to convert written text into audible speech. This process, also known as text-to-speech (TTS), is widely used in applications where human-like voices are required for interaction. It relies on algorithms and linguistic models to generate speech that closely resembles natural human vocalization. Such software is integrated into various devices, including smartphones, virtual assistants, and accessibility tools, enabling users to engage with technology through sound rather than visual interfaces.

At its core, speech synthesis involves the manipulation of recorded human sounds or the generation of voice elements through digital means. The software typically breaks down the text into smaller components like words and phonemes, processes them, and then assembles them into a coherent voice output. Modern speech synthesis tools aim to produce speech that sounds fluid, accurate, and natural by improving voice quality and intonation patterns.

Key Components of Speech Synthesis

  • Text Analysis: The software first analyzes the input text to identify syntax, grammar, and punctuation, which helps in determining the tone and rhythm of the generated speech.
  • Phoneme Conversion: Text is then converted into phonemes, the smallest units of sound in speech, to ensure accurate pronunciation.
  • Waveform Generation: Finally, these phonemes are used to generate speech through pre-recorded audio clips or by creating synthetic sound waves from scratch.

How Speech Synthesis Works in Practice

  1. Input Text: The system receives written text, which can come from various sources such as documents or websites.
  2. Text Processing: The text is broken down into manageable linguistic units like sentences, words, and syllables.
  3. Phonetic Translation: Each word is transformed into phonetic representations to ensure correct pronunciation.
  4. Speech Generation: The phonetic data is used to produce the corresponding speech, either by stringing together pre-recorded sounds or generating the sound from scratch using digital models.

"Modern speech synthesis systems use deep learning techniques to make voices sound more natural and adaptable to different contexts."

Comparison of Speech Synthesis Techniques

Method Description Advantages
Concatenative Synthesis Uses pre-recorded speech segments to generate full sentences. High-quality, natural-sounding voice output.
Formant Synthesis Generates speech by manipulating sound waveforms rather than using recordings. Requires less memory, flexible for different languages.
Neural Synthesis Utilizes deep neural networks to produce speech based on training data. Produces highly realistic and adaptable voices, particularly in dynamic settings.

Key Features of Speech Synthesis Software for Different Use Cases

Speech synthesis software plays a crucial role in transforming written text into natural-sounding speech. Depending on the specific application, the features required from such software can vary significantly. Whether for accessibility, virtual assistants, or content creation, the capabilities of speech synthesis tools are tailored to meet the demands of different industries and user needs.

This technology must adapt to different contexts, offering high-quality voice output, ease of integration, and adaptability to various platforms. Let’s examine key features that make speech synthesis effective for specific use cases.

Features for Accessibility Tools

For accessibility applications, the primary focus is on clarity, ease of use, and customization for individuals with visual impairments or reading difficulties.

  • Voice Clarity: Clear and accurate pronunciation of diverse vocabulary, with special emphasis on readability.
  • Customizable Speech: The ability to adjust speed, pitch, and tone for users’ specific needs.
  • Support for Multiple Languages: Essential for users from different linguistic backgrounds.
  • Text Highlighting: Syncing spoken words with on-screen text for better comprehension.

Features for Virtual Assistants

Virtual assistants require speech synthesis that sounds natural and human-like. This is crucial for ensuring smooth interaction and engagement with users.

  • Natural Prosody: Emulating conversational tone and cadence to mimic human speech patterns.
  • Interactive Feedback: Real-time response to user inputs with dynamic conversational abilities.
  • Context-Awareness: Adjusting tone and style based on the context of the interaction (e.g., formal vs informal).
  • Voice Variety: Multiple voice options to personalize the assistant’s personality or tone.

Speech Synthesis for Content Creation

For content creators such as podcasters, audiobook authors, or video producers, speech synthesis should provide a high level of audio fidelity and expressive capability.

  1. High-Fidelity Audio: Crisp, clear audio that is ideal for content that will be distributed to audiences.
  2. Expressiveness: Capability to convey emotions and tone variations for engaging narratives.
  3. Custom Voice Design: The ability to design a unique voice, including accents and vocal characteristics, to match specific content styles.
  4. Seamless Integration: Easy integration with other content production tools (e.g., video editing software).

Comparison of Key Features

Feature Accessibility Virtual Assistants Content Creation
Voice Clarity
Customizable Speech
Natural Prosody
Voice Variety
Support for Multiple Languages
Expressiveness

For each use case, the focus on certain features–such as clarity for accessibility or expressiveness for content creation–determines the overall effectiveness and usability of speech synthesis software.

How to Choose the Best Speech Synthesis Tool for Your Business

Choosing the right speech synthesis software can significantly improve your business operations, whether you’re automating customer service or adding accessibility features to your website. When evaluating options, it’s crucial to focus on features that align with your specific needs and objectives. Below, we discuss the main factors to consider when selecting a tool for your business.

Before making a decision, businesses should prioritize accuracy, voice quality, and customization options. A powerful speech synthesis system can enhance user experience and even streamline internal processes like training or content creation.

Key Factors to Consider

  • Voice Quality: The clarity and naturalness of the voice output are critical. Ensure the software supports high-quality, realistic voices that match the tone of your business.
  • Customization Options: Some tools allow you to adjust voice parameters such as speed, pitch, and emphasis. Customizable voices are ideal for creating a consistent brand identity.
  • Multilingual Support: If your business operates internationally, choose a tool that offers a variety of languages and accents to cater to diverse audiences.
  • Integration Capabilities: Ensure that the software easily integrates with your existing systems, whether it's your website, CRM, or other platforms.
  • Cost vs. Features: Evaluate the software based on its pricing structure in relation to the features it provides. Consider the scalability of the solution as your business grows.

Comparison Table of Popular Speech Synthesis Tools

Tool Voice Quality Languages Supported Customization Price
Tool A High 20+ Basic $$
Tool B Very High 50+ Advanced $$$
Tool C Medium 10+ Limited $

"It's important to test the tools in real-world scenarios to determine which one aligns best with your business needs."

Final Thoughts

Choosing the right speech synthesis software requires careful evaluation of the features that matter most to your business. By focusing on voice quality, customization, and integration capabilities, you can select a tool that enhances your customer experience while maintaining operational efficiency.

Integrating Speech Synthesis into Your Existing Systems: A Step-by-Step Guide

Incorporating speech synthesis technology into your existing systems can greatly enhance user interaction and accessibility. Whether you're looking to improve customer service, add voice output to your application, or simply modernize your digital environment, the integration process is straightforward with the right tools and approach. Below is a structured guide to help you seamlessly integrate this technology into your infrastructure.

This guide outlines the essential steps, from initial setup to testing and deployment. By following these instructions, you can ensure a smooth and efficient process that delivers quality results. Keep in mind that proper integration depends on your system's architecture, the chosen speech synthesis API, and specific use cases.

Step-by-Step Integration Process

  1. Choose the Right Speech Synthesis Tool

    Select a speech synthesis API or library that fits your system’s requirements. Look for compatibility with your existing platform and the ability to customize voice characteristics, such as pitch and speed.

  2. Set Up API or Library

    Install the required dependencies and set up the speech synthesis engine. Follow the documentation provided by the chosen tool to ensure correct installation.

  3. Integrate with System Code

    Incorporate the API or library into your system’s code. Ensure proper communication between your application and the speech engine to handle text-to-speech conversions smoothly.

  4. Adjust Output Settings

    Customize voice settings, including language, tone, and speed. This is critical for delivering a personalized experience that aligns with your application’s purpose.

  5. Test and Debug

    Run comprehensive tests to identify any issues with voice output. Pay attention to performance, accuracy, and response time to ensure that everything functions as expected.

  6. Deploy to Production

    Once testing is successful, deploy the speech synthesis integration into your live environment. Monitor user interactions to ensure smooth operation.

Important Considerations

Ensure Accessibility: Make sure that the speech output is clear and understandable for all users, including those with hearing impairments or language differences.

Scalability: Choose a solution that scales with your system as usage grows. Cloud-based services may offer more flexibility in this regard.

Example Integration Table

Step Action Tools/Resources
1 Select API/Library Google Cloud Text-to-Speech, Amazon Polly
2 Install Dependencies Documentation, package managers (npm, pip)
3 Code Integration API keys, SDKs
4 Customize Settings Voice configuration parameters
5 Test & Debug Automated testing tools
6 Deploy CI/CD pipelines, production servers

Cost Considerations: Is Investing in Speech Synthesis Software Justified?

Speech synthesis software can bring significant advantages, but its cost is a crucial factor for businesses and individuals considering implementation. While the technology has advanced tremendously, offering high-quality voice generation and wide-ranging applications, it's important to weigh the benefits against the initial and ongoing expenses. Depending on the provider, pricing models may vary greatly, and understanding these differences is key to making an informed decision.

The price of speech synthesis tools can be influenced by several factors, such as the quality of the voices, customization options, and usage frequency. Some software offers affordable packages with basic functionalities, while others may come with premium features that justify a higher cost. However, ongoing maintenance and additional charges for voice libraries can increase the total investment.

Key Costs to Consider

  • Initial Investment: Many speech synthesis software solutions require a one-time or subscription-based fee for access to core features. Some may offer a free trial period to assess the product before committing financially.
  • Customization Features: If you require specialized voices or fine-tuned pronunciation, the cost can escalate. High-quality custom voices typically come with higher price tags.
  • Ongoing Maintenance: Some solutions require updates or regular licensing fees. This can add to the overall cost, especially for businesses using the software regularly.

Pros and Cons of the Investment

Investing in speech synthesis software can enhance accessibility and efficiency, but it's essential to consider whether the long-term benefits align with your financial resources.

  1. Pros:
    • Improved accessibility for users with visual impairments or learning disabilities.
    • Efficiency in automating content creation or customer support tasks.
    • Potential cost savings in voiceover work for media and entertainment industries.
  2. Cons:
    • High-quality solutions can be expensive, especially with custom voices.
    • Ongoing costs related to updates, voice packs, or premium features.
    • Dependence on software for natural-sounding speech might not always be feasible for all users.

Cost Comparison Table

Feature Basic Plan Advanced Plan Premium Plan
Price $10/month $30/month $100/month
Voice Quality Standard Voices High-Quality Voices Custom Voices
Customization None Limited Full
Support Email Phone & Email 24/7 Dedicated Support

How Speech Synthesis Software Can Enhance Customer Experience in Service Industries

In today’s competitive service sector, businesses are increasingly relying on technology to improve customer satisfaction. One of the most effective ways to achieve this is through the use of speech synthesis software, which allows companies to provide fast, accurate, and personalized responses to customer inquiries. This technology can significantly improve customer interactions, making them more efficient, accessible, and engaging.

By integrating speech synthesis into customer service operations, businesses can enhance the overall experience in several key ways. Customers benefit from clear and natural-sounding voice responses, reducing frustration and improving engagement. Additionally, automated systems powered by speech synthesis software can operate 24/7, ensuring that customers receive assistance anytime they need it.

Key Benefits of Speech Synthesis in Customer Service

  • Faster response times: Speech synthesis allows for quick and seamless communication, which can reduce wait times for customers.
  • Increased accessibility: Text-to-speech capabilities make information more accessible to customers with disabilities, such as those with visual impairments.
  • Consistency: Automated systems deliver the same quality of service every time, ensuring uniformity in customer interactions.
  • Personalization: Speech synthesis software can be tailored to include customer names or specific preferences, creating a more personalized experience.

Examples of Application

  1. Call centers: Automated systems use speech synthesis to provide answers to frequently asked questions, allowing agents to focus on more complex issues.
  2. Voice assistants: Businesses integrate speech synthesis into apps or devices to guide customers through services such as ordering or booking.
  3. Interactive kiosks: Many service-based industries use kiosks with speech synthesis to provide instructions and product information to customers in public spaces.

Comparison of Speech Synthesis Providers

Provider Features Pricing
Provider A High-quality voices, multilingual support, API integration Subscription-based, tiered pricing
Provider B Customizable voices, advanced speech modulation, cloud-based Pay-as-you-go
Provider C Real-time speech output, multiple language options Flat rate pricing

“The use of speech synthesis in service industries not only improves operational efficiency but also builds stronger relationships with customers by offering them consistent and reliable assistance.”

Top Speech Synthesis Software Solutions and Their Unique Benefits

Speech synthesis technology has evolved significantly over the past few years, providing users with a wide range of software solutions that can convert text into natural-sounding speech. These tools are commonly used in various industries, including accessibility, education, and entertainment. Each speech synthesis software offers distinct features, making it crucial to choose the one that best fits specific needs.

Below are some of the leading speech synthesis tools that stand out for their unique capabilities and benefits. These solutions not only provide high-quality voice output but also cater to different requirements, such as multilingual support, customization, and integration with other technologies.

1. Google Text-to-Speech

Google's solution offers seamless integration with a variety of devices and applications. It is known for its clarity and natural-sounding voices, especially in mobile environments.

  • Supports a wide range of languages and accents.
  • Customizable speech rates and pitch adjustments.
  • Ideal for mobile app developers and Android users.

2. Amazon Polly

Amazon Polly uses advanced deep learning models to produce lifelike speech. It stands out due to its flexibility and scalability for enterprise-level applications.

  • Realistic voice options powered by AI.
  • Supports SSML (Speech Synthesis Markup Language) for enhanced speech customization.
  • Provides integration with AWS services for enterprise solutions.

3. Microsoft Azure Speech Service

Microsoft Azure’s offering in speech synthesis excels with robust features suitable for various industries, including healthcare and customer service.

  • High-quality, customizable voices with neural network technology.
  • Supports real-time translation and transcription alongside speech synthesis.
  • Comprehensive API for integration with other Microsoft products and services.

4. iSpeech

iSpeech provides an easy-to-use platform with versatile features designed for both individual and professional use cases. It’s ideal for users seeking simplicity and flexibility.

  • Quick conversion of text to speech in multiple formats.
  • Supports both commercial and personal usage with licensing options.
  • Offers voice customization and batch processing tools.

"The choice of speech synthesis software depends largely on the specific needs of the user, such as whether they prioritize voice quality, language support, or integration with other services."

Software Key Feature Best For
Google Text-to-Speech Natural voices, mobile integration Mobile developers
Amazon Polly AI-powered realistic voices, scalability Enterprise solutions
Microsoft Azure Customizable voices, real-time transcription Professional services
iSpeech Simple interface, voice customization Personal and professional use